MAINTENANCE
100 - 300 Hour Maintenance Interval

Perform these procedures more often for vehicles subjected to severe use.
E Emission Control System Service (California)
 Have an authorized Polaris dealer perform these services.
Item
Maintenance Interval
(whichever comes first)
Remarks
Hours Calendar
Miles
(Km)

E
Fuel System 100 H 12M -
Check for leaks at tank cap, fuel lines, fuel
pump, and fuel rail.
Replace lines every two years.

Radiator 100 H 12M - Inspect; clean external surfaces

Cooling Hoses 100 H 12M - Inspect for leaks

Engine Mounts 100 H 12M - Inspect
Exhaust Muffler / Pipe 100 H 12M - Inspect

E
Spark Plug 100 H 12M - Inspect; replace as needed

Wiring 100 H 12M -
Inspect for wear, routing, security; apply
dielectric grease to connectors subjected to
water, mud, etc.
 Clutches (Drive and Driven) 100 H 12M - Inspect; clean; replace worn parts
 Front Wheel Bearings 100 H 12M - Inspect; replace as needed
 Toe Adjustment 100 H
Inspect periodically; adjust when parts are
replaced
 Brake Fluid 200 H 24M - Change every two years (DOT 4)
Spark Arrestor 300 H 36M - Clean out


Auxiliary Brake - Inspect daily; adjust as needed
Headlight Aim - Adjust as needed
